## Changelog — Twigsweep v2.4.0

Heads up, future maintainers: we renamed `TW_TOKEN` to `TW_CLEANUP_KEY` because people kept confusing it with the dashboard token (fair enough, honestly). The bot that prunes stale branches on Harlowe Forge reads only the new name now; the old one is silently ignored as of this release, no deprecation warning. Update any env files you've squirreled away.

Your env file should now include the renamed secret on the next line:

env line for fafof-fahag: LEDGER_TOKEN5=f8790

Ticket VLT-commentary: The Marrowfield vault holding the EXIF-scrub signing key is locked after three failed attempts during the Pellwick release. The scrubber (strips GPS and serial tags before upload to Dunehall storage) cannot sign builds until unlocked. Future maintainers: follow the unseal runbook carefully, one attempt at a time. Unseal using the recovery passphrase recorded below.

unlock words, fahog-kahag: sorix-lamath-oliax-quenok-caswyn-wenys-istmir-wenir-weneth-juldor-ulaax-fraax-praiel-jorix

Handover for the Crashbin pipeline. It ingests crash reports from the Petrel mobile app, batches them, and ships summaries to triage. Watch the queue depth; anything over 10k means the parser is stuck. Restarting the worker usually fixes it. Talk to Dara for access. Current production config follows.

config for hahif-yahop:
[istox]
port = 9000
region = central-3
host = istox.zarqelnet.test
team = noviel
timeout_ms = 500
retries = 5

### Step 4: Enable idempotency key storage

Before enabling payment retries in Tollgate, new team members must provision the idempotency key table. Each retry attempt checks this table to ensure a charge is processed exactly once, even after network failures. Run the provided migration script, then configure the key store using the connection string below.

warehouse DSN: mssql://rusdor_svc:0FSWCn9@db-951a.paliqforge.local:5432/ulawyn